搜索系统漏洞深度排查与索引修复优化实践
|
在现代信息系统中,搜索功能是用户获取信息的核心途径之一。然而,随着数据量的不断增长和系统复杂性的提升,搜索系统的性能和准确性可能会受到影响。因此,定期进行系统漏洞深度排查与索引修复优化显得尤为重要。 漏洞排查的第一步是全面了解当前系统的架构和运行状态。通过分析日志、监控数据以及用户反馈,可以识别出潜在的问题点。例如,某些查询可能因索引缺失而导致响应时间过长,或者某些数据未能正确索引,影响搜索结果的完整性。 在排查过程中,应重点关注数据库结构、索引配置以及查询语句的执行效率。使用专业的工具对索引进行分析,可以帮助发现重复或无效的索引项,从而减少存储开销并提升查询速度。同时,检查是否有未被正确更新的数据,避免因数据不一致导致的搜索错误。 索引修复优化需要结合实际业务需求进行调整。对于高频查询字段,可以适当增加索引以提高检索效率;而对于低频字段,则可考虑减少索引数量,以降低维护成本。定期重建索引也是一种有效的优化手段,有助于清理碎片化数据,提升整体性能。 除了技术层面的优化,还应关注系统安全方面的问题。确保索引机制不受恶意攻击的影响,防止数据泄露或篡改。通过设置合理的权限控制和审计机制,能够有效降低风险。
AI生成的趋势图,仅供参考 建立一套完善的监控和反馈机制,是保障搜索系统长期稳定运行的关键。通过实时监测性能指标和用户行为,可以及时发现问题并进行调整,从而持续提升用户体验。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

